  • We’re seeking compassionate and skilled Intensive In-Home Clinicians to deliver high-level, personalized therapeutic services directly in clients’ homes. Working with children, adolescents, and young adults facing complex mental health challenges—including mood disorders, trauma, and behavioral issues—you will provide intensive one-on-one support and crisis stabilization.

    Responsibilities include developing and implementing tailored treatment plans using evidence-based approaches (CBT, DBT, trauma-focused therapy), collaborating with families and caregivers, and promoting long-term emotional well-being and coping skills in real-world environments. This role is ideal for clinicians who thrive in client-centered, hands-on settings and are committed to making a lasting impact.

  • We’re looking for dedicated Behavior Assistants to provide personalized, in-home support to youth experiencing behavioral challenges. Working alongside licensed clinicians, you will implement behavior modification strategies, teach new skills, and address concerns such as aggression, anxiety, and social difficulties.

    You’ll collaborate closely with families, caregivers, and other professionals to develop tailored plans that promote positive behavior, improve daily functioning, and foster independence. This hands-on role involves direct one-on-one interactions, modeling appropriate behavior, and helping youth practice coping strategies in real-world settings.

  • We’re seeking caring and motivated Mentors to provide in-home guidance, support, and life skills training to at-risk youth ages 4–21. Our mentoring services focus on building positive relationships, fostering personal development, and helping young people achieve meaningful goals such as improving academics, developing social skills, and overcoming behavioral or family-related challenges.

    As a Mentor, you’ll create a safe, supportive environment tailored to each individual’s needs. This includes regular meetings, goal-setting, and progress monitoring to enhance self-esteem, confidence, and overall well-being. The one-on-one, in-home approach allows you to make a real difference for youth who may not thrive in traditional settings.

  • We’re looking for experienced Virtual Clinicians to deliver high-quality, evidence-based mental health services to children, adolescents, and families via secure online platforms. You’ll provide therapy, guidance, and support remotely—helping clients manage mood disorders, trauma, behavioral challenges, and family dynamics from the comfort of their own homes.

    As a Virtual Clinician, you’ll conduct assessments, develop individualized treatment plans, and use modalities such as CBT, DBT, or trauma-focused therapy. You’ll also collaborate with caregivers and other professionals to ensure continuity of care and long-term success. This role is ideal for licensed clinicians who excel in telehealth and value flexible, client-centered care.

  • We’re seeking compassionate Nurturing Parent Coaches to guide and support parents and caregivers in building stronger, healthier family dynamics. Through individualized, in-home or virtual coaching, you’ll help parents develop practical strategies for effective communication, positive discipline, and emotional connection with their children.

    As a Nurturing Parent Coach, you’ll provide hands-on guidance, model supportive parenting techniques, and offer tools to manage stress, improve routines, and nurture healthy child development. By fostering positive relationships and practical skills, you’ll empower families to create stable, supportive home environments where children can thrive.

  • Clinical Supervision Support provides guidance and oversight to mental health professionals, such as therapists, counselors, and clinicians, to ensure the quality and effectiveness of their practice. Led by a licensed and experienced supervisor, this support aims to foster professional development, enhance clinical skills, and ensure ethical and evidence-based practices.

    Clinical supervision involves regular meetings where clinicians can discuss challenging cases, receive feedback, and explore therapeutic techniques and interventions. It also serves as a safeguard to ensure that clinicians are providing competent, culturally sensitive, and client-centered care. This support is essential for maintaining high standards of practice, promoting professional growth, and ensuring positive outcomes for clients.
